  • Dry Tortugas National Park

    Dry Tortugas National Park 100 Grinnell Street, Key West, FL, United States

    Join for a thrilling birding adventure led by expert field guides Michael Bothers & Mitchell Harris. The Dry Tortugas, with its seven small islands, is a vital stopover for migratory birds traveling between South America and the US, making it a hotspot on the Great Florida Birding Trail.
